Ajarae Coleman is an actor, coach, and entrepreneur whose journey exemplifies the power of following one's artistic calling while building meaningful communities along the way. Growing up in New Jersey, she found early academic success that led her to boarding school through a fortuitous scholarship, followed by Harvard where she studied biological anthropology.
After graduation, her path took her to Los Angeles through Teach for America, where she taught in Compton for two years. This experience, while demanding, revealed her deep capacity for impact and connection with others. During a subsequent corporate role at McMaster Car Supply Company, she discovered her passion for acting through evening classes.
Making the pivotal decision to pursue acting professionally in 2009, Ajarae approached the transition methodically, researching the industry and creating Workshop Guru, a platform connecting actors with casting workshops. This entrepreneurial venture naturally evolved into coaching, where she helps other actors navigate their careers while maintaining her own acting pursuits.
Throughout her journey, Ajarae has developed a disciplined approach to success, incorporating morning routines, accountability partnerships, and strategic goal-setting. Her current focus includes landing a series lead role in a single-camera comedy while expanding her presence internationally.
Now at a personal and professional crossroads, Ajarae is embracing expansion by planning to split her time between Los Angeles and London, viewing this next chapter as an opportunity to grow her artistic career and community across continents.

About your host: After 30+ years working first as an actor and then a career in IT culminating as the CEO of a software company, I walked away from everything at the end of 2021 close to burnout and in a poor state of mental health. I ended up driving luxury cars around the UK, delivering them to dealerships and customers, and relished the space it gave me to think and simply BE. 2.5 years later I returned to the 22 year old Pete, sitting on the top deck of a bus wondering what his life would be like if he went to drama school, and reestablished myself in a creative career as an actor and producer.
